#744458 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#744458 is composed of 45.5% red, 26.7%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 41.4% magenta, 24.1%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 335 degrees, a saturation of 26.1% and a lightness of 36.1%. #744458 color hex could be obtained by blending #e888b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#744458

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050304 is the darkest color, while #fbf7f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#744458

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f595c is the less saturated color, while #b4044d is the most saturated one.
